20100131107CONTROLLING PROCESS FOR REFRIGERATOR - According to a method of controlling a refrigerator in accordance with the present invention, a refrigerating chamber and a freezing chamber are cooled at the same time, one and the other of the refrigerating chamber and the freezing chamber are cooled sequentially, and refrigerant recovery is then performed. Accordingly, upon initial start-up of a refrigerator, a temperature within each chamber can be cooled more rapidly through simultaneous cooling. Further, when a compressor is actuated again after being off, refrigerant can be supplied to each evaporator smoothly through a refrigerant recovery step. Accordingly, there is an advantage in that the cooling performance of a freezing cycle can be improved.05-27-2010

20090104689Microchip For Use In Cytometry, Velocimetry And Cell Sorting Using Polyelectrolytic Salt Bridges - The present invention relates to a microchip using polyelectrolyte salt bridge for cytometry, velocimetry, and cell sorting. The microchip comprises; a) an inlet for solution to be analyzed, b) a microchannel which provides a moving passage for solution to be analyzed, c) at least one outlet for solution to be analyzed which has passed through the moving passage, d) at least one electrode system comprising a first and a second salt bridges connected to the microchannel (the two salt bridges face each other), and a first and a second reservoirs connected to said each salt bridge (the reservoir comprises electrode and standard electrolyte solution). The microchip detects analytes in the solution to be analyzed (for example, a cell) by detecting change of impedance. In detail, anion in the standard electrolyte solution, which is comprised in the first reservoir, moves from the first salt bridge to the second salt bridge across the microchannel. Impedance change occurs by interference of anion moving across the microchannel and the change can be detected by impedance analyzer connected to electrodes in the first and the second reservoirs.04-23-2009

20090107844GLASS ELECTROPHORESIS MICROCHIP AND METHOD OF MANUFACTURING THE SAME BY MEMS FABRICATION - Embodiments of the present invention may provide a microchip applicable to an electrophoresis employing UV detection and a method of manufacturing the same. The microchip of the present invention has a glass channel plate, which is formed on an upper surface thereof with a loading channel and a separation channel and is provided on the upper surface thereof with an optical slit layer made of silicon except the channel region, and a glass reservoir plate, which is formed with sample solution reservoirs and buffer solution reservoirs. The loading channel and the separation channel are formed on the channel plate by deep reactive ion etching. The sample solution reservoirs and the buffer solution reservoirs are formed in the reservoir plate by sand blasting. The channel plate and the reservoir plate are combined by anodic bonding the optical slit layer and the reservoir plate. Electrodes for sample and electrodes for buffer are deposited by sputtering Pt with a shadow mask after anodic bonding.04-30-2009
